Kevin Black, CEO, U Can Fly Holdings


With a resume that reads like the Top 100 Chart in the Hip-Hop, R&B and Pop genres, veteran music executive Kevin Black has contributed to the success of countless recording artists.

Household names like Madonna, Linkin Park, Eminem, Gwen Stefani, Black Eyed Peas, Mary J. Blige, Keyshia Cole, Prince, Marilyn Manson and Cher all can credit part of their success

and careers to the efforts of Bronx-native Kevin Black. Citing multi-platinum status with over a billion dollars in combined revenue, record labels and artist

(both major and independent, alike) have relied on Kevin Black’s expertise, vision, tenacity, and drive to take their careers to the next level.


After an honorable discharge from the Marine Corps., Black started his career as a roadie and eventual tour manager for the pioneering rap group Run DMC, Black quickly made a name for himself through out the industry as the ‘go-to-guy.’ Traveling the world with the legends of rap afforded Black the ability to segue in to the on-air radio personality field as one of the hottest DJs and mixers on the west coast in the mid-eighties on KJLH-FM.

Always on the cusp and able to recognize the next phenomenon before it hit the masses, Black was hired as the National Promotions Director at Death Row Records. A marketing and promotional whiz, Black designed award-winning promotional campaigns for new artists that garnered more than $100 million in revenue, orchestrated national tours and dozens of music videos that further heightened the visibility of Death Row’s roster to the world-wide audience. Under Black’s reign he managed 68 employees and acted as the media liaison all while managing a $5 million annual budget. Black is also credited as one of the forefathers of the “Street Team” department in the music industry; still widely used by all record labels today. Initially hiring, training and directing 60 “street promoters” this model of grass roots promotion is at the core of any successful awareness campaign.

After his stint at Death Row and a subsequent position at EMI Records, Black worked with world champion basketball great Shaquille O’Neil’s newly-formed T.W.I.S.M. (The World Is Mine) Records as Senior Vice President. With an ear for talent and the keen ability to envision the big picture, Black used his contacts in the industry to cultivate and secure brand partnerships for the optimum exposure of the new joint venture with A&M Records. With a roster of artists that included Shaquille O’Neil and Ice Cube, again Black’s marketing expertise and savvy promotional campaigns garnered the new label an impressive first year with 3.5 million units sold.

Never one to shy away from a challenge, early in 2001 Black was now on the verge of creating one of the most powerful modern-day entities in record label history. During Black’s tenure as Vice President of Interscope’s Rap Department the label generated more than $600 million in annual revenues…consistently. From its infancy, Interscope’s Rap Department under Black’s direction cultivated and expanded the brand awareness of artists like Eminem, 50 Cent, Black Eyed Peas, The Game and Gwen Stefani. Interscope’s Rap Department secured positions at the top of Billboard’s charts, numerous RIAA gold and platinum certifications, heavy rotation on radio and on video networks. Supervising and managing 40 national employees, Black’s team promoted 182 records that sold more than 120 million copies.

During his time at Interscope Records, Black also threw his hat in the political ring on the marketing side. As co-founder of the “Vote of Die” initiative with Sean “P. Diddy” Combs, Black helped to secure the endorsements of recording artists Mary J.Blige, Mariah Carey and 50 Cent as they encouraged young voters to exercise their right to vote.

After his 5 years at Interscope Records, Black was offered a high-ranking executive position in the Chairman’s office at Warner Bros. Records. Brought in to manage a $20 million annual budget and supervise 50 national employees, Black quickly executed strategies to drive world-wide exposure, increase label and brand awareness while increasing revenue for the Warner Urban Music Division. While at WMG, Black conceptualized and implemented national awareness campaigns for artists like Linkin Park, Eric Beet, Madonna and Cher that spurred a 15% spike in sales despite a negative economic sales climate.

Now as the captain of his ship in 2008 Kevin Black opened his own company under the shingle, U CAN FLY HOLDINGS. As CEO and President, Black is poised to take branding, strategic marketing and promotions to the next level.
